Samsung’s Exynos chipset became eventually popular when it was launched with Samsung’s Galaxy S and Note lineup. Samsung always prepares a new Exynos chipset for their high-end smartphones.

The reason why we are talking about Samsung’s Exynos chipset is that the company had just announced a new flagship mobile processor in the Exynos 9 series that is built on the 10nm process.

It is rumored that the new Exynos 9 Series 9810 SoC will be the processor that will power the company’s upcoming flagship phone, the Samsung Galaxy S9.

Exynos 9810 is the company’s newest top-of-the-line processor. It features custom third-generation processing cores and an updated video processing unit. In terms of connectivity, it will support LTE (4G) connections with speeds up to 1.2 gigabits per second.
